C. Etrich et al., Limits for interchannel frequency separation in a soliton wavelength-division multiplexing system - art. no. 016609, PHYS REV E, 6302(2), 2001, pp. 6609
We identify the required interchannel frequency separation of the input fie
ld for a soliton wavelength-division multiplexing (WDM) system. It is found
that the critical frequency separation above which WDM with solitons is fe
asible increases with the number of transmission channels. Moreover, it is
shown that a combination of time- and wavelength-division multiplexing yiel
ds the largest transmission capacity. Finally, the structure of the soliton
spectra which correspond to the frequency separation smaller than the crit
ical frequency is discussed.
